City manager updates council on litigation, FEMA timelines and denied SCADA grant
Summary
City Manager updated council on two lawsuits, a water-management-plan administrative hold, FEMA's EHP review for a creek project (likely 1–2 years), a hazard-mitigation grant that would leave an estimated $346,750 city share if awarded, and a denied Bureau of Reclamation SCADA grant that staff will research for eligibility on resubmission.
The City Manager briefed council on litigation and several major infrastructure and grant developments that shape Wheeler's project pipeline.
Litigation: staff reported Botts Marsh LLC v. City of Wheeler remains in mediation with the schedule extended to July 5, 2024; brownfield testing is underway at the site and staff expect a conditional-use application for part of the property.
